The fine print that actually matters to punters
The flashy bonus numbers on a homepage are there for a reason, but the real story lives in the terms and conditions, which is where a lot of operators try to bury the lede. Wagering requirements, game restrictions, maximum bet limits during bonus play, and withdrawal caps all add up to a picture that is very different from the one painted in the marketing copy. A decent platform will make those terms readable, and I mean actually readable, not a wall of legal text that requires a magnifying glass and a strong coffee to parse. Playing responsibly is part of the deal, and the operators that take that seriously build it into the experience rather than treating it as a footnote. Deposit limits, session reminders, and clear self-exclusion options are not there to kill the mood, they are there to keep the mood from turning into a regretful Monday morning. We found that the platforms with the strongest reputations are the ones that make responsible play tools easy to find and easy to use, which is a refreshing change from the old approach of pretending that problem play does not exist.
